The Opportunity:

We are seeking a Recruitment Resourcer to support our growing, reputable, successful Private Practice team in London. This is a fantastic opportunity for an entry level candidate to start their career in recruitment!




The Role:

  • To build a continuous talent pipeline of candidates
  • Registering candidates, updating our database and sharing best practice with the wide team.
  • Develop a strong knowledge and understanding of the market you are recruiting into - In the competitive world of recruitment, the biggest challenge will be becoming a known entity to candidates and clients
  • To assist in interviewing candidates alongside Directors, as well as coordinating interviews for them (i.e. liaising with candidates and clients, setting up interviews)
  • To generate candidates using typical sourcing/mapping strategies; e.g.: database, LinkedIn, referral’s, head hunting


  • Map out specific vertical clients and populate with key decision makers as well as potential candidates
